APCI FCU provides financial services to Air Products and Chemicals, Inc., Contractors, and Versum Materials plus Select Employer Groups and to members of their immediate family and households. The APCI FCU provides a broad range of financial related products and services including mobile banking, remote deposit capture, vehicle loans, refinance mortgage loans, personal loans, MasterCard, savings, checking, money market account, certificates and IRAs. Loan amounts range from $500 to $1,200,000 while individual member deposits range from $5 to over $1,000,000. While having only a single physical location in Allentown, PA, the APCI FCU’s members span over the 50 U.S. states in addition to a small international contingent. Larger member concentrations are in Pennsylvania, Texas, California, Arizona, and Louisiana. The APCI FCU reaches its members through a variety of channels including internet, mobile app, telephone, outbound calls, and direct mail.
